What the T&Cs Really Say

Because nobody reads the fine print, we’ll do it for you. The bonus cash you earn from those spins can’t be withdrawn until you’ve rolled over it 30 times. That means if you manage to hit a modest win of $10, you’ll need to gamble $300 before you can even think about cashing out.
